The Music

Mozartian elegance and grace surround Beethoven’s Piano Concerto No 3, a work that includes moments of profound beauty, especially in the yearning second movement.

In his Fifth Symphony, Shostakovich proved his music could achieve mass appeal, as Stalin demanded. But beneath its brilliant tunes lies a darker, more sardonic work.

The Performers

Joining the LSO and Sir Antonio Pappano is Bruce Liu, winner of the 2021 International Chopin Piano Competition and one of today’s most versatile pianists.
